Why This Book Feels Like Magic
🌙 A Love Story That Transcends Time: Imagine love that isn’t just about two people longing for each other but about transforming souls. Rumi and Shams have a bond that isn’t romantic, yet it’s the most passionate connection you can imagine—one that breaks rules, shatters identities, and creates something divine. At the same time, in modern-day Massachusetts, Ella, a woman stuck in a lifeless marriage, reads about their story and finds herself falling for a man she’s never met.
✨ Shams of Tabriz: The Mysterious Rulebreaker
Shams is the kind of character who walks into a story and turns everything upside down. He’s fearless, intense, and has an almost magical presence. He doesn’t just teach Rumi about love—he forces him to experience it, even when it means losing everything. If you love characters who challenge the world and don’t care about rules (cough Jacks cough), Shams will definitely intrigue you.
💌 Forty Rules That Will Stay With You Forever
Scattered throughout the book are Shams’s forty rules of love, each one like a small secret whispered into your ear. Some of them feel comforting, others hit you like lightning, but all of them make you see love—and life—differently. For example:
“The path to the Truth is a labor of the heart, not of the head. Make your heart your primary guide! Not your mind.”

My Review :
If you enjoy books that feel like poetry, where every sentence carries beauty and meaning, then The Forty Rules of Love will captivate you with its lyrical and elegant writing. This book is not just about storytelling; it is an emotional journey that delves deep into themes of love, faith, and personal transformation.
Beyond romance, it explores the idea that love is a force that shapes our souls, pushing us to grow, heal, and see the world differently. It encourages reflection on life’s deeper questions—what it means to love, to seek truth, and to find oneself in the process. Through the wisdom of Rumi and Shams of Tabriz, it offers lessons that stay with you long after you’ve turned the last page.
